Abstract

Single channel speech separation system with frame based pitch range estimation is presented. The system decomposes the input mixture speech into frames and pitch of the speech is estimated in each frame of modulation spectrum by using summary autocorrelation function (SACF) analysis. In this method, each frame is divided into two, above and below 1 KHz and compute generalized autocorrelation for periodicity detection. By using this pitch range, a mask is created to filter the target speech from noisy mixture speech. Performance evaluation of the proposed system shows a better response compared to the existing methods.
